Australian Wool Research and Promotion Organisation Regulations 2(Amendment)

I, The Governor-General of the Commonwealth of Australia, acting with the advice of the Federal Executive Council and having taken into consideration the recommendation with respect to the amount to be prescribed for the purposes of subsection 79 (3) of the Australian Wool Research and Promotion Organisation Act 1993 made to the Minister for Primary Industries and Energy by the Wool Council of Australia, make the following Regulations under that Act.

Dated 25 September 1996.

 WILLIAM DEANE

 Governor-General

By His Excellency’s Command,

JOHN ANDERSON

Minister for Primary Industries and Energy

____________

1.   Amendment

1.1   The Australian Wool Research and Promotion Organisation Regulations are amended as set out in these Regulations.

[NOTE: These Regulations commence on gazettal: see Acts Interpretation Act 1901, s. 48.]

2.   Regulation 5 (Contribution to costs of exotic animal disease control)

2.1   Omit the regulation, substitute:

Contributions to costs of Australian Animal Health Council

 “5.(1)For the purposes of subsection 79 (3) of the Act, the total amount of contributions in respect of the financial year ending on 30 June 1996 is $141,898.

 “(2)For the purposes of subsection 79 (3) of the Act, the total amount of contributions in respect of the financial year ending on 30 June 1997 is $164,422.”.
